Buying Guide for the Best Nail Gun For Crafts

Choosing the right nail gun for crafts can make your projects easier, faster, and more enjoyable. When selecting a nail gun, it's important to consider the type of projects you'll be working on, the materials you'll be using, and your own comfort and safety. Here are some key specifications to help you make an informed decision.
Type of Nail GunThere are several types of nail guns, including brad nailers, finish nailers, and pin nailers. Brad nailers are versatile and great for small to medium projects, finish nailers are ideal for more detailed work, and pin nailers are perfect for delicate tasks. Choose the type that best matches the scale and detail of your craft projects.
Nail SizeNail size refers to the length and gauge of the nails the gun can handle. Smaller nails (18-gauge or 23-gauge) are suitable for delicate crafts and thin materials, while larger nails (15-gauge or 16-gauge) are better for heavier materials and more substantial projects. Consider the thickness and type of materials you'll be working with to determine the appropriate nail size.
Power SourceNail guns can be powered by electricity, batteries, or air compressors. Electric and battery-powered nail guns are more portable and convenient for small, quick projects, while pneumatic (air compressor) nail guns offer more power and are better for larger, more demanding tasks. Think about where you'll be using the nail gun and how much power you'll need.
Weight and ErgonomicsThe weight and design of the nail gun can affect your comfort and ease of use. Lighter nail guns are easier to handle and reduce fatigue, especially during long crafting sessions. Ergonomic designs with comfortable grips can also make a big difference. Try to find a nail gun that feels comfortable in your hand and is easy to maneuver.
Depth AdjustmentDepth adjustment allows you to control how deep the nails are driven into the material. This feature is important for achieving a professional finish and preventing damage to your projects. Look for a nail gun with easy-to-use depth adjustment settings so you can customize the nail depth based on the material and project requirements.
Safety FeaturesSafety features such as trigger locks, anti-dry fire mechanisms, and protective guards are crucial for preventing accidents and injuries. Ensure the nail gun you choose has adequate safety features to protect you while you work. Prioritize models that offer comprehensive safety mechanisms to keep your crafting experience safe and enjoyable.
